Inspect Water Usage



Analyze your water costs and also track your water usage. As the one paying it, you need to discover if there are any kind of discrepancies. If you detect sudden changes, regardless of your consumption coinciding, it suggests that you have leaks in your plumbing system. Remember, your water expense should fall under the very same range monthly. An unexpected spike in your expense indicates a fast-moving leak.

A constant rise every month, also with the exact same practices, reveals you have a sluggish leak that's also slowly intensifying. Call a plumber to completely check your home, particularly if you feel a warm area on your flooring with piping below.

Analyze the circumstance and inspect



Home owners must make it a habit to examine under the sink counters as well as even inside closets for any bad odor or mold development. These 2 red flags indicate a leak so timely attention is needed. Doing regular inspections, also bi-annually, can conserve you from a significant trouble.

Check Out the Water Meter



Examining it is a surefire way that assists you uncover leaks. If it moves, that suggests a fast-moving leakage. This implies you may have a sluggish leak that can also be underground.


Asses Outside Lines



Do not neglect to inspect your exterior water lines also. Needs to water leak out of the link, you have a loosened rubber gasket. One tiny leakage can lose lots of water and spike your water costs.

WARNING SIGNS OF WATER LEAKAGE BEHIND THE WALL


PERSISTENT MUSTY ODORS


As water slowly drips from a leaky pipe inside the wall, flooring and sheetrock stay damp and develop an odor similar to wet cardboard. It generates a musty smell that can help you find hidden leaks.




MOLD IN UNUSUAL AREAS


Mold usually grows in wet areas like kitchens, baths and laundry rooms. If you spot the stuff on walls or baseboards in other rooms of the house, it’s a good indicator of undetected water leaks.




STAINS THAT GROW


When mold thrives around a leaky pipe, it sometimes takes hold on the inside surface of the affected wall. A growing stain on otherwise clean sheetrock is often your sign of a hidden plumbing problem.




PEELING OR BUBBLING WALLPAPER / PAINT


This clue is easy to miss in rooms that don’t get much use. When you see wallpaper separating along seams or paint bubbling or flaking off the wall, blame sheetrock that stays wet because of an undetected leak.




BUCKLED CEILINGS AND STAINED FLOORS


If ceilings or floors in bathrooms, kitchens or laundry areas develop structural problems, don’t rule out constant damp inside the walls. Wet sheetrock can affect adjacent framing, flooring and ceilings.
